The yearly precipitation here at Kalmia Lake is about average; most of the rain falls throughout December while July is typically the driest month.

               a pleasant vista of Caesar Peak from Kalmia Lake. Summertime highs at Kalmia Lake typically tend to be in the 80's; the overnight is somewhat cooler of course, mostly in the 40's. During the winter the highs are usually in the 40's; winter nights come with lows in the 20's to Kalmia Lake.
